介绍 随着加密货币的日益普及,越来越多的人开始使用各种数字资产和钱包进行交易。在这个过程中,小狐狸钱包(...
区块链是一种分布式账本技术,能够通过去中心化的方式记录和验证事务。其核心特性包括不可篡改性、透明性、去中心化和安全性。这些特性为数字资产交易提供了很大的安全保障。然而,尽管区块链本身被设计为安全的系统,但它的安全性仍然受到多种因素的影响。
区块链的安全性主要来源于它的去中心化特性,这意味着数据不依赖单一实体,而是分布在整个网络中。通过密码学技术,区块链能够确保数据的安全性和隐私性。此外,区块链中的每个区块都与前一个区块通过密码学哈希函数连接,使得一旦数据被写入区块链,就几乎不可能被篡改。这种特性在金融、市场交易以及数据存储等多个领域得到了广泛应用。
在理解数字区块链的安全性时,几个关键特性是必须要强调的:
尽管区块链的设计初衷是安全的,但仍然有多种潜在威胁,可能影响其安全性:
在区块链的世界中,确保安全性的策略和最佳实践有助于降低潜在风险:
在数字资产领域,区块链技术为资产保护提供了强大的支持。无论是加密货币、NFT,还是其他类型的数字资产,区块链的安全性体现在以下几个方面:
在了解数字区块链安全的过程中,以下六个问题是用户普遍关注的:
51%攻击是指当某个节点或矿工控制了网络超过50%的计算能力(算力)时,他们就能对区块链网络的运行进行控制。这种攻击能够让攻击者重新组织交易、双重花费等行为。攻击者可以选择将某些交易从区块链中删除,或者阻止特定交易确认。由于这样的攻击需要巨大的资源投入,理论上可行但在实践中成本高昂,然而在参与者较少的小型区块链中更可能发生。
为了防止51%攻击,开发者通常建议增加网络节点的数量,提高去中心化程度,以及采取更复杂的共识机制,如权益证明(PoS)和耐量证明(PBFT)等,以降低攻击的可能性。
智能合约是区块链上的自执行合约,其安全性与编写代码的正确性密切相关。智能合约的安全漏洞通常源于程序员的错误、设计方面的缺陷或对外部环境的变化未做出响应。例如,常见的重放攻击、时间操纵、整数溢出等都是智能合约存在的潜在漏洞。若合约中存在这些漏洞,攻击者便能够利用其获取未授权的资金。
解决这一问题的最佳实践包括在编写合约后进行全面的代码审查和安全测试,使用成熟的框架和库,保持合约代码的简洁性,以及实施一个滚动版本管理的策略,以便在发现漏洞时能进行快速的修复。
网络钓鱼攻击是最常见的数字安全威胁之一,攻击者通过伪装成可信用户或应用程序,诱使用户输入敏感信息。保护自己免受网络钓鱼的最佳方法包括:确认发件人信息、检查链接的安全性,不随便点击不明链接、不在不熟悉的网站上输入敏感信息等。同时,用户应教育自己与他人,了解识别网络钓鱼攻击的常见特征,提高警惕。
社交工程攻击则侧重于人际操控,通过欺骗手段引导受害者泄露敏感信息。用户可以通过建立良好的安全文化,进行安全意识培训,确保所有成员都了解如何保护个人和组织的数据安全。
区块链的安全不仅依赖于网络的设计和算法,还依赖于每一个参与者的节点安全。节点一旦被攻破,攻击者可以窃取数据、操控系统和发起拒绝服务攻击(DDoS)。因此,确保节点的安全需要采用防火墙、加密、定期备份和安全隔离等策略。
此外,节点运营者应定期更新和维护系统,及时检测和修复漏洞,确保所有安全补丁都得到应用。这样,才能最大限度地减少整个网络受到的威胁。
在许多区块链项目中,选择一个可靠的项目进行投资是至关重要的。投资者应关注项目的白皮书、团队背景、技术实施道路、市场需求、社区活动等多个方面。确保项目拥有透明的治理结构和强大的社区支持,其中不仅包括开发者的活跃度,还有用户支持和参与度。此外,查看项目的合规性和合法性,是否经过第三方审计也是必不可少的环节。
此外,了解项目的经济模型、代币的用途以及未来的扩展潜力,结合市场趋势和自身投资风险承受能力,做出理性选择。
未来,区块链技术将朝着更高的安全性、更强的可扩展性和更广泛的应用方向发展。当前,越来越多的行业正在探索区块链的应用,包括金融服务、供应链管理、医疗健康、艺术品交易等。这一过程中,区块链技术也在不断成熟,正在朝着与人工智能、物联网(IoT)等新兴技术的结合发展。
同时,推动区块链的监管合规也是未来的重要发展方向,以确保技术在促进创新的同时,也能有效地保护用户的权益。随着技术的推陈出新,区块链的安全性也将不断增强,满足快速发展的数字经济的需求。
总结: 通过以上内容,我们对数字区块链安全的概念、特性、面临的威胁、保护措施等进行了全面的探讨。这一复杂领域正在快速发展,保持对新趋势和最佳实践的关注,将有助于保证用户的资产和交易安全。